European Phenylketonuria – PKU Guidelines

The European Guidelines for Phenylketonuria is one of the latest projects funded by E.S.PKU. The project was started after the publication of the consensus paper, written by delegates of E.S.PKU, showing the needs and wishes for guidelines. Under the lead of Professor Francjan J. van Spronsen and E.S.PKU SAC (scientific advisory committee) those independent PKU guidelines have been developed, with the help of about 20 professionals, experts in PKU, over the past three years. At the annual E.S.PKU conference 2015 in Berlin, Germany- excerpts from these guidelines were presented to the professionals as well as parents/patients.

One of the main aims of the Guidelines is that they are well received by professionals within Europe. Therefore those have to be published within a medical journal first. This is exactly what is planned for the year 2016. As soon as the guidelines are published more information can be made available. There will be more understandable versions of the guidelines for patients and relatives as well.
